Merge tag 'block-5.15-2021-09-25' of git://git.kernel.dk/linux-block
Pull block fixes from Jens Axboe: - NVMe pull request via Christoph: - keep ctrl->namespaces ordered (Christoph Hellwig) - fix incorrect h2cdata pdu offset accounting in nvme-tcp (Sagi Grimberg) - handled updated hw_queues in nvme-fc more carefully (Daniel Wagner, James Smart) - md lock order fix (Christoph) - fallocate locking fix (Ming) - blktrace UAF fix (Zhihao) - rq-qos bio tracking fix (Ming) * tag 'block-5.15-2021-09-25' of git://git.kernel.dk/linux-block: block: hold ->invalidate_lock in blkdev_fallocate blktrace: Fix uaf in blk_trace access after removing by sysfs block: don't call rq_qos_ops->done_bio if the bio isn't tracked md: fix a lock order reversal in md_alloc nvme: keep ctrl->namespaces ordered nvme-tcp: fix incorrect h2cdata pdu offset accounting nvme-fc: remove freeze/unfreeze around update_nr_hw_queues nvme-fc: avoid race between time out and tear down nvme-fc: update hardware queues before using them
No related branches found
No related tags found
Showing
- block/bio.c 1 addition, 1 deletionblock/bio.c
- block/fops.c 10 additions, 11 deletionsblock/fops.c
- drivers/md/md.c 0 additions, 5 deletionsdrivers/md/md.c
- drivers/nvme/host/core.c 17 additions, 16 deletionsdrivers/nvme/host/core.c
- drivers/nvme/host/fc.c 9 additions, 9 deletionsdrivers/nvme/host/fc.c
- drivers/nvme/host/tcp.c 10 additions, 3 deletionsdrivers/nvme/host/tcp.c
- kernel/trace/blktrace.c 8 additions, 0 deletionskernel/trace/blktrace.c
Loading
Please register or sign in to comment